Adoptees and Americans: Exporting Hans Christian Andersen and Karen Blixen (Isak Dinesen)

Hans Christian Andersen and Karen Blixen (aka.) Isak Dinesen have been widely read in America, with Hollywood’s Out of Africa adaptation adding to the attention. Both writers dramatized their alienation with adoption stories reaching across national and racial boundaries. They became iconic writers...
